Summary: | Stenella coeruleoalba (Meyen, 1833). Nova Acta Acad. Caes. Nat. Curios., 16(2):609, pl. 43. TYPE LOCALITY: "an der östlichen Küste von Südamerika; wir karpunirten ihn in der Gegend des Rio de la Plata." (= South Atlantic Ocean near Rio de la Plata, off coast of Argentina and Uruguay). DISTRIBUTION: Worldwide: cold-temperate to tropical waters. STATUS: CITES - Appendix II. SYNONYMS: asthenops, crotaphiscus, euphrosyne, styx, tethyos. COMMENTS: See Mitchell (1970:720). Perrin et al. (1981, 1987) gave a revised synonymy of this species. Published as part of James G. Mead & Robert L. Brownell, Jr., 1993, Order Cetacea, pp. 349-364 in Mammal Species of the World (2 nd Edition), Washington and London :Smithsonian Institution Press on page 356, DOI: 10.5281/zenodo.7352970 |
